What is Sims-ing It Out?
1.
To pretend to be engaged in conversation with an inanimate object (wall, plant,glass of beer, etc.)usually in the context of acting in a play or peformance.
"Whitney, you were totally sims-ing it out over there with that wall, come over here and talk to your new friend Doug."
